Output 40b451f28faba32333e72b19cbe8bfa4f5f13783c3fd00a56584ca2011f187a2:18

value
450900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c0cbf824537fdc2243e9ea7e53592b258af442 OP_EQUAL
address
MRCUuSSpC2sujNpRNB4iY1EWJou6wSLysk
transaction
40b451f28faba32333e72b19cbe8bfa4f5f13783c3fd00a56584ca2011f187a2
spent
true